About the Author

Samy Swayd teaches courses on religious diversity and Islamic Studies at San Diego State University (SDSU). He is the founder and acting director of the Institute of Druze Studies (IDS), the co-editor of the Journal of Druze Studies (JDS), and the author of The Druzes: An Annotated Bibliography (1998) and Druze Scriptural Identity (forthcoming).

Reviews

This book is on an interesting topic, and there is not much else available on the subject, so libraries catering for readers in comparative theology or for people concerned with the history and politics of the Levant should consider acquiring copies. Reference Reviews, Vol. 21, No. 2 (2007) In nearly 1,000 entries, Swayd (world religion, religious diversity and comparative mysticism, San Diego State U.) describes the practices of people who, since the founding of their faith in the eleventh century, have been prohibited from proselytizing, resisted assimilation and even disguised their beliefs from both friends and enemies. He outlines the history and growth of discipleship, the ways in which the Druze differentiate the initiated from the not, and the means by which they remain intact in identity. Swayd's chronology and maps are very helpful, and his introduction gives readers a very good idea of what we know about this resilient and esoteric sect. Reference and Research Book News
